Late Games Galore

Sunday October 5, 2008
There are several intriguing match-ups on tap this afternoon in the NFL, with the surprising Buffalo Bills at the top of the list, as they travel to face Arizona today. The sports services are all over the Cardinals and as a result, Arizona is now favored by two points and the line may reach 2.5 as game time approaches.

While this would appear to be an ideal situation for the Cardinals to pull off the victory, it's extremely hard to put your money on the same side as almost everybody else. It's all part of the guessing game that takes place this time of year, as on paper at least, the Bills should probably be the favorites. A number of bettors will see Arizona favored and think it's a "trap" to get you to bet on Buffalo and therefore will bet on the Cardinals. Others will think the oddsmakers are trying to trick them into betting into the trap and be tempted to take Buffalo.

Another interesting game is New England at San Francisco, as the Patriots are favored by 3.5 points over the improved 49ers. The Patriots are favored by reputation alone in this game, but that doesn't mean they won't be able to cover the point spread. A number of services are on both sides, with a small lean to the 49ers.

There are plenty of other games, including the baseball playoffs and the NHL match-up between Pittsburgh and Ottawa, so sports gamblers should have an enjoyable day.
